引言

前端设计是现代网页和应用程序开发的核心部分,它涉及到用户界面(UI)和用户体验(UX)的设计与实现。对于想要在这一领域深入学习和提高的人来说,高效复习是关键。本文将为你提供一份全面的前端设计复习攻略,帮助你掌握前端设计的基础知识,提升技能。

第一部分:前端设计基础知识

1.1 HTML 基础

  • 主题句:HTML 是构建网页结构的基础。
  • 内容
    • HTML5 的新特性介绍。
    • 常用标签的详细解释和示例代码。
    • 表单元素和语义化标签的使用。

1.2 CSS 基础

  • 主题句:CSS 负责网页的样式设计。
  • 内容
    • 选择器、属性和值的详细介绍。
    • 常用布局技术,如 Flexbox 和 Grid。
    • 响应式设计原则和实践。

1.3 JavaScript 基础

  • 主题句:JavaScript 使网页具有交互性。
  • 内容
    • 基本语法和变量、函数的使用。
    • 事件处理和 DOM 操作。
    • 异步编程和 Fetch API。

第二部分:前端设计进阶

2.1 前端框架和库

  • 主题句:前端框架和库可以提高开发效率。
  • 内容
    • React、Vue 和 Angular 的基本概念和使用方法。
    • React Router 和 Vue Router 的路由管理。
    • Vuex 和 Redux 的状态管理。

2.2 版本控制

  • 主题句:版本控制是前端开发的重要工具。
  • 内容
    • Git 的基本操作和分支管理。
    • 使用 GitHub 进行代码托管和协作。

2.3 性能优化

  • 主题句:性能优化是提升用户体验的关键。
  • 内容
    • 代码压缩和优化技术。
    • 图片和资源的懒加载。
    • 使用 Webpack 等工具进行打包。

第三部分:实战演练与项目经验

3.1 项目规划

  • 主题句:良好的项目规划是成功的关键。
  • 内容
    • 项目需求分析和技术选型。
    • 项目进度管理和风险评估。

3.2 实战案例

  • 主题句:通过实战案例提升技能。
  • 内容
    • 创建一个简单的博客网站。
    • 实现一个电商平台的购物车功能。

3.3 反馈与迭代

  • 主题句:持续改进是前端设计的核心。
  • 内容
    • 用户反馈收集和分析。
    • 根据反馈进行迭代优化。

第四部分:总结与展望

4.1 总结

  • 主题句:回顾前端设计学习过程。
  • 内容
    • 总结学习过程中的关键点和难点。
    • 强调实践和持续学习的重要性。

4.2 展望

  • 主题句:展望前端设计的发展趋势。
  • 内容
    • 前端技术的新趋势,如 WebAssembly 和 Service Workers。
    • 前端设计与人工智能的融合。

通过以上四个部分,你将能够系统地学习和掌握前端设计的相关知识,并通过实战提升自己的技能。记住,持续学习和实践是成为前端设计专家的关键。